The technology behind noise-cancelling earplugs is fascinating. They typically utilize a combination of passive noise isolation and active noise cancellation. Passive noise isolation works by physically blocking sound waves from entering the ear, while active noise cancellation uses microphones to detect external sounds and generate sound waves that are the exact opposite, effectively canceling them out. This dual approach makes noise-cancelling earplugs particularly effective in environments with consistent background noise, such as airplanes or busy offices.
When selecting the right pair of noise-cancelling earplugs, it is essential to consider the fit and comfort. Many models come with various ear tip sizes and materials, allowing users to find the perfect fit for their ears. A snug fit not only enhances noise cancellation but also ensures that the earplugs remain comfortable during extended wear. Moreover, the material of the ear tips can affect both comfort and sound isolation. Silicone tips, for example, are often softer and more comfortable, while foam tips provide excellent noise isolation.
In addition to comfort, the level of noise reduction offered by different earplugs varies significantly. Some models are designed for high levels of noise reduction, making them ideal for heavy machinery or concerts. Others are better suited for moderate noise environments, such as cafes or libraries. Understanding the noise reduction rating (NRR) of earplugs is crucial for users to select the appropriate pair for their specific needs. The NRR is a numerical value that indicates how much sound is blocked, and it can help users make informed decisions.
Battery life is another critical factor to consider when evaluating noise-cancelling earplugs. Many modern earplugs come equipped with rechargeable batteries, providing convenience for users who may forget to carry spare batteries. The longevity of the battery can vary by model, with some offering up to 20 hours of continuous use on a single charge. Users should also consider how quickly the earplugs recharge, as this can impact their usability during travel or long workdays.
